Ladies are Dons of double-header!

14 May 2014

MK Dons Ladies came out on top in a gruelling double-header with Norwich City at stadiummk, drawing the first match 2-2 before winning the second 4-1.


In the first of the two matches, the Dons started off slowly and conceded the first goal within 58 seconds. Hannah Clancy failed to clear a cross which allowed the Norwich striker to head past goalkeeper Emma Kirby.
City’s early goal was the wake-up call the Dons needed and they responded just five minutes later when a fantastic diagonal ball from Charly Wright found Leah Cudone and she poked the ball in to make it 1-1.

The score remained all-square until half-time but soon after the re-start, Norwich restored their lead.

Dons, though, continued to press their opponents and they were rewarded with an equaliser in the 85th minute courtesy of Emily Mann, who was in the right place at the right time to prod home after Eden Washington had done excellently to block a clearance from the Norwich keeper.

After a short break, the two sides returned to the field for game two and, just like in the first match, Norwich were the team who struck first when the home side failed to deal with a long ball forward.

Matt French’s side, though, responded soon after through Leah Cudone who, when played through on goal, finished into the bottom corner from the edge of the area.

City then had a great chance to restore their lead from a free-kick only for Kirby to deny them with a superb diving save to tip the ball over the bar, and that stop proved all the more important in the second half when the Dons gained the advantage.

After some great football in the Norwich half, the ball found its way to Lil Stanton and she executed an inch-perfect lob over the City keeper from 30 yards out to make it 2-1.

Not content to rest on their slender advantage, the Dons went in search of a third goal which they found courtesy of Charly Wright, who finished coolly after beating two Norwich defenders in the box.

Chloe Smith later tapped home after Cudone hit the post to secure the victory for the Dons and add three points to the one they collected earlier in the day.

The two results sees the Dons Ladies finish their 2013/14 season in 5th place in the South East Combination League table.
